Output 5186f62f78aa0c1fd10a104e7570dac453166f5b97f5da8c5ea2fed7a3cf9332:1

value
2485360414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5deaef16d65ac04f8e9ed0bb1311b0a06830a13 OP_EQUAL
address
3Q74ErVSY1cs4iwy3fB1XtSd5861KM8vx9
transaction
5186f62f78aa0c1fd10a104e7570dac453166f5b97f5da8c5ea2fed7a3cf9332
spent
true